GQ0A0295R3FFT Description
GQ0A0295R3FFT Description
The GQ0A0295R3FFT from TT Electronics/IRC is a high-performance thin-film resistor network designed for precision applications. This 20-pin QSOP package features 10 isolated resistors, each with a 95.3Ω resistance, 1% tolerance, and a ±50ppm/°C temperature coefficient. Encased in a ceramic substrate, it offers superior thermal stability and durability, with a maximum operating temperature of 125°C. The 1W total power rating (0.1W per resistor) and 100V maximum voltage rating make it suitable for demanding circuits. Its gull-wing termination ensures reliable surface-mount (SMD) assembly, while the QSOP package (8.66mm x 6.02mm x 1.47mm) optimizes board space.
GQ0A0295R3FFT Features
- Precision Thin Film Technology: Delivers low noise and high stability for sensitive analog/digital circuits.
- Isolated Resistor Network (ISOL): Each of the 10 resistors operates independently, reducing crosstalk.
- Ceramic Case: Enhances thermal dissipation and mechanical robustness in harsh environments.
- Wide Temperature Range: Operates from 70°C to 125°C with derated power, ideal for industrial applications.
- Tight Tolerances: 1% resistance tolerance and ±0.1mm dimensional precision ensure consistent performance.
- High Voltage Handling: Supports up to 100V, making it suitable for power supply and signal conditioning.
